Essential Components for Your Android RC Setup

Before you take to the skies, let’s gather the essential components that will make your Android RC helicopter dream a reality:

1. Compatible RC Helicopter: The first step is to ensure your RC helicopter is compatible with Android control. Look for helicopters that offer a dedicated Android app or have an open-source flight controller that can be programmed for Android compatibility.

2. Android Device: Any Android phone or tablet will suffice. However, a larger screen with a responsive touchscreen will enhance your flying experience.

3. Bluetooth Module: Most modern RC helicopters come equipped with Bluetooth. If yours doesn’t, you’ll need to purchase a compatible Bluetooth module to connect your Android device.

4. Android App: The heart of your Android RC setup is the app. There are numerous apps available, each with its unique features and control schemes. We’ll explore some popular options later in this guide.

Setting Up Your Android RC Helicopter

Now that you have your components ready, let’s set up your Android RC helicopter for flight:

1. Pair Your Devices: Turn on your RC helicopter‘s Bluetooth module and pair it with your Android device.

2. Launch the App: Open the Android RC app you’ve chosen and follow the on-screen instructions to connect to your helicopter.

3. Calibrate Controls: Most apps require you to calibrate the controls to ensure accurate responsiveness.

4. Familiarize Yourself: Take some time to practice in a safe environment, getting acquainted with the app’s interface and the helicopter’s flight characteristics.

Mastering the Art of Android RC Helicopter Control

Controlling an RC helicopter with Android is a rewarding experience, but it requires practice and patience. Here are some tips to help you master the art:

1. Start Slowly: Begin with basic maneuvers, gradually increasing your skill level as you gain confidence.

2. Practice Hovering: Mastering hovering is crucial for controlling your helicopter. Practice maintaining stable altitude and position.

3. Use Throttle Carefully: The throttle controls the helicopter’s altitude. Use it cautiously, avoiding abrupt movements.

4. Understand Pitch and Roll: Pitch controls the helicopter’s forward and backward movement, while roll controls side-to-side movement.

5. Experiment with Flight Modes: Many RC helicopters offer different flight modes, such as Beginner, Intermediate, and Advanced. Experiment with these modes to find the one that suits your skill level.
